What is MetaMask?

MetaMask is a cryptocurrency wallet and gateway to blockchain apps. It allows users to manage their Ethereum-based assets and interact with decentralized applications (dApps) directly from their browser.

With over 30 million users worldwide, MetaMask has become the most popular Web3 wallet for accessing the decentralized web.

How Login Works

MetaMask login provides a secure alternative to traditional username/password authentication. Instead of creating accounts on each website, you simply connect your wallet.

When you "login" with MetaMask, you're cryptographically proving ownership of your Ethereum address without exposing your private keys.

How to Use MetaMask Login

Using MetaMask to access decentralized applications is straightforward and secure. Follow these general steps:

1

Install MetaMask

Download and install the MetaMask browser extension or mobile app from the official website or app store.

2

Create or Import Wallet

Set up a new wallet or import an existing one using your secret recovery phrase. Always store this phrase securely.

3

Visit a dApp

Navigate to a decentralized application that supports MetaMask login. Look for a "Connect Wallet" or similar option.

4

Connect Your Wallet

Select MetaMask from the wallet options. A popup will appear requesting connection approval.

5

Verify Connection

Review the permissions requested by the dApp and confirm the connection in your MetaMask wallet.

6

Access Granted

Once connected, you can interact with the dApp using your Ethereum address as your identity.

Security Features

MetaMask prioritizes security while maintaining usability. Here are key security aspects of the login process:

Private Key Security

Your private keys are stored locally on your device and never shared with websites or servers.

Transaction Confirmation

All transactions require explicit approval, preventing unauthorized actions.

Phishing Protection

MetaMask includes detection for known phishing sites to protect your assets.

Permission Control

You control which sites can connect to your wallet and what permissions they have.
